MTN moves into the mobile advertising market

June 15, 2012deolaAdvertising, Branding, entrepreneur1 comment

 

Since all things are going Local, social and Mobile; avenues which make content delivery a cost effective, targeted and measurable means for brands to directly target advertising at the mobile phones of prospects and customers who would want/need their products and services in a more measurable manner than many other channels currently provide. 

 

Features

  • iSMS mobile advertisements are text based mobile advertisements that request information from the customer. These types of mobile advertisements are particularly useful in gathering customer data are customer replies are toll free.
  • MMS mobile advertisements offer picture, colour, animation and sound allowing the advertisements to contain more for an enhanced experience.
  • SMS Flash Message mobile advertisements are text based messages that pop up on your screen making it impossible for you to miss. It is also possible for the customer to save for future action.
  • Rich Media mobile advertisements allows the full complement of video, sound, picture, animation, text and everything else that make for an all-engaging advertisement. This however, would require that the recipient has a smartphone and internet.
  • Location based mobile advertisements are used by organizations to target customers who are in close proximity to their shops, restaurants, showrooms etc where products, services, promos or offers are currently available. These advertisements can be received by customers in various mobile advertising formats.
  • USSD Flash Message mobile advertisements pop up on the phone of the recipient making them impossible to ignore. Unlike SMS flash message mobile advertisements these advertisements cannot be saved.
  • IVR advertisements are jingles played to customers calling the MTN Call Centre as they wait to be attended to. This is strictly an opt-in service and is only played to the customer upon acceptance.
  • Caller tunes are jingles played to callers to organizations who subscribe to this service. An organization can choose to make all customers/prospects that call any of its contact numbers or any of its staff numbers, hear it jingle while waiting for the call to be picked.

What MTN Mobile Ads Means to the Consumer

With MTN Mobile Ads, the consumer will now be:

  • Kept up to date with products, services, offers and promotions that are of interest.
  • Able to access offers or promos directly from his/her mobile phones by simply clicking a link or making a call.
  • Able to benefit from advertising whether or not he/she has access to TV, radio or newspapers.

What MTN Mobile Ads Means to the Media Agency

As a media agency, MTN Mobile Ads offer you:

  • A broader range of channels to offer your customers to reach their target market.
  • Deliver richer, more effective integrated marketing communications media plans developed for your customers.
  • An additional revenue stream.

What MTN Mobile Ads Means to Brand Managers

To brand managers in various organisations, MTN Mobile Ads offer:

  • A direct channel through which you can reach your profiled target audience.
  • A smart means of optimizing your advertising budget.
  • A complementary form of advertising that makes your integrated marketing communications plans more comprehensive and watertight.
  • An advertising channel for which it is easy to track and measure return on investment.
